MEMO — Sales Leads

Procurement is vetting second-source suppliers for the Kelden valve assembly. Marrow Industrial's single-source position is now a risk flag. Shortlist due in three weeks; qualification runs eight. Do not discuss sourcing changes with accounts until cleared. Quote lead times conservatively in the interim. Context on the underlying strategy follows below.

board note of bajop-yaweg: The western region missed its Pelys quota by 58.0 percent last quarter. Pelysek Foods plans to raise the Belius list price by 44.0 percent in July. The steering committee signed off on a budget of $133.8 million for Project Pelax. The renewal with Zoraelix Systems closes at $61.9 million a year, 12.7 percent above the last contract.

Subject: SQL lint cut-over complete

Hi all — the cut-over to the new Querystone lint ruleset for SQL files finished this morning. All repos under the Fennwick data platform now run the strict profile in CI; the legacy advisory-only mode is retired. Expect failures on uppercase keywords, implicit joins, and missing semicolons. Existing files were auto-fixed in the migration branch; only net-new violations will block merges. For review purposes, the linter now runs with the following configuration values.

config for bawig-fadup:
[zorix]
host = zorix.lumicworks.corp
user = zorix_svc
database = zorix_prod

Subject: Handover — Duskline dashboard theming

Hey Marguerite,

Leaving some notes for whoever inherits the Ombra admin dashboard. Dark mode mostly works, but theme preferences are stored per-user in the settings table, and a few legacy rows still have null theme values — those users see a blinding white flash on login. There's a backfill script in the repo that patches them. It expects the settings database, reachable with the connection string below.

replica DSN, kajep-yahag: mssql://praok_svc:iF@db-8d68.plorvaio.local:5432/eliion

Hi — as requested for your security review, here's a summary of Tuesday's disaster-recovery drill for Paritywatch, our hotel rate-parity checker. We simulated total loss of the primary scraping region; failover to the standby cluster completed in eleven minutes, within target. One gap: the comparison database restore required manual intervention because the restore tooling could not read its sealed credentials automatically. The sealed bundle must be opened by an operator entering the recovery passphrase, which appears below.

vault phrase of bagaf-kajeg = jorath-feniel-briir-siliel-ralix